> > We're going to use Patchwork to track Linaro patches, but instead of
> > subscribing to all mailing lists to which patches may be sent, we're
> > asking all Linaro developers to CC a common email address whenever they
> > send a patch upstream, and we'll then feed all mail delivered to that
> > address into Patchwork.
> 
> I don't see the reasoning for doing this - it's more work (once-off setup vs 
> getting every contributor to do stuff repeatedly) and less reliable 
> (contributors may forget to add the magic address, or not know about this 
> requirement).

Maybe I wasn't clear, but this is not to track patches sent to Linaro;
what we want is to track patches sent upstream by engineers working for
Linaro.  It already is the company's policy that all patches sent
upstream should be CCed to this magic address, and feeding that address'
mailbox to patchwork.linaro.org seemed like a better alternative than
continuously having to subscribe patchwork.l.o to the mailing lists of
all different projects that Linaro engineers may contribute to (we don't
have a list of all these projects beforehand and we expect it to grow
all the time).
